Musnuf groaned, How am I supposed to deal with this as*hole? He’d completely overpowered him.
The chains disappeared by themself after a few minutes and he was free. He jumped up from the ground. He looked for the other disciple. He’d doused the fire but he was in no fit state.
A long trailing chain extended down from the sky and coiled around his foot. He looked very afraid with his half-cooked face and was yanked up into the sky.
It must be Elder Flower.
He felt exhausted, his clothes were a mess, he was a mess. He had his webnovel in his pocket and he couldn’t use it. He was bound to a sect that he couldn’t escape unless he performed a rite that could rip everything away from and even if he escaped from this sect. It wouldn’t matter. His life would be in peace for a year or so and then the Great Hegemon of the Black Jade Sect woke up.
He sat back down on his butt. This was too much for him. He wasn’t meant for this. He liked eating junk food, playing games and being an absolute waste-man.
I still have to get a single ring. He got back up and started wandering around. It was with less enthusiasm but he kept his eyes peeled open and the wave of emotions at bay.
Then he spotted a cave. He started walking down to it. It was quite muddy near the entrance. An ominous feeling rose up in his chest and he spotted a pair of dark red eyes in there. He started backing away slowly.
He slipped and fell down on the ground. He started scrambling away on all fours and a roar burst out of the cave. His ears started ringing but he couldn’t stop.
Advertisement
A giant bear burst out of the cave. It’s fur was matted in red here and there. Steam emanated off its body. Musnuf turned around to look at it. It had a conspicuous red ring on its foot.
He started strategizing. Everything melted away and his sole focus was on survival. I have to provoke it.
Musnuf got up and started backing away. He formed a giant stone wall all of a sudden. His nose started bleeding out with the sudden outflux of essence. His head started hurting. This was by far the biggest illusion he’d attempted. Once he was far enough, he started circling back.
He climbed over the cave’s mouth. The bear was confused and it pawed at the illusion. I have to finish this fast.
He focused on its foot and the wall burst into flames. A giant semi-circle of fire extended out in a circle around the bear. It roared but this time there was a hint of fear. The circle of fire was just an illusion but he had to convince the bear it was real.
The bear tried to paw at the flame and he formed a whip of his ghost flame and lashed it at its hands. He started making it smaller. The bear backed away until it was in its cave.
It was a delicate process and blood was flowing out of his nose like a waterfall. He clutched onto consciousness like he was in a war. I’m going to win!
Once the bear was in the cave, he executed the next step. He formed a giant brick wall in front of the cave. He needed it to stay there. Now he was stuck. He didn’t have an unlimited amount of essence and no way to deal with it.
He let the wall dissipate, the construct fading. He wiped the blood off and shuddered. He started meditating. It wasn’t the right place but he had to recover his essence. Stay in there, stay in there…
Advertisement
Once he’d recovered his essence to a respectable degree he started thinking. Killing it was not the only option. He just had to get his hands on the ring.
He started thinking and formed a flame. It burst into fire on top of his hand. He molded it into a chain and cast an illusion on it. He made it pitch black. It was like wrapping an illusionary tape around the chain.
He hopped down from the cave and sent it in. He couldn’t see in too much but he did make out its eyes and that was all he needed. He guided the chain to its face and the beast growled. It must’ve been feeling the heat.
The chain burst out, the illusion dissipating the moment he no longer needed it and it coiled around the beast's eyes.
He poured as much essence into it as possible. THe beast roared and he stumbled, blood pouring from his ears. It felt like a sharp needle had been shoved into his ears.
The creature blasted its way out of the cave. Its fur bursting into fire. It swiped in a haphazard manner trying to get rid of its pain.
Musnuf just backed away and smiled. Once the creature was done with its rampage. It whimpered and coiled up onto itself.
He was waiting. He used Amplification to heighten its feelings of exhaustion and despair. That was what he needed.
He crept up on it and shoved his dagger into its throat. He was about to pull out but the bear swiped at him. He was launched across the clearing and crashed into a tree. The air was knocked out of him. He felt horrible.
Blood was bursting out of its throat like a geyser and it started rampaging. It took off running. Swiping, destroying and burning away anything in its path.
Musnuf got up and started chasing after it. A trail of blood left in its wake. It wasn’t easy to take life from a creature.
It was a matter of time before it stumbled onto a person and it happened to be Enduring Wave. His light blue robe with the knitted wave pattern was launched away. He rolled away on the ground and spotted the ring as well.
Musnuf groaned. Brilliant. How lucky can he be?
